One of Seattle’s newest waterfront restaurants, Lakeside, opened on June 16th, just in time for the summer. Located at Lake Union Piers (formerly Chandler’s Cove), Lakeside offers guests unparalleled views of the downtown Seattle skyline and Lake Union while enjoying a five-course prix fixe dinner menu, weekend brunch, or a sip-and-savor a la carte menu featuring bold flavors and unique ingredients.
Lakeside features a seasonal menu of Pacific Northwest favorites, sourced locally and prepared traditionally, often incorporating Central American flavors. The bar includes rotating local brews, wine from some of the best vineyards in Washington and Oregon, and handcrafted cocktails made with locally distilled spirits. Lakeside is the newest offering from family owned and operated Waterways Cruises and Events, a mainstay on Seattle’s Lakes and Puget Sound since 1994. “We are thrilled to bring our commitment to elevated customer service and excellent food ashore,” said co-owner Hilton Smith. “This waterfront location is an opportunity for us to engage with our loyal guests in a new, yet familiar way. Lakeside fills a niche in the neighborhood, offering contemporary, casual fare from a trusted staff at an accessible price for most.”
The culinary team will be led by Executive Chef Trinity Mack, and the restaurant will be managed by Waterways Cruises and Events’ General Manager Jeff Culton.
